Abstract
Meth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A) is endemic in healthcare settings in Indonesia.To evaluate the effect of a bundle of preventive measures on the transmission and acquisition of MRSA in a surgical ward of a resource-limited hospital in Indonesia.The study consisted of a pre-intervention (7 months), intervention (2 months), and post-intervention phase (5 months) and included screening for MRSA among eligible patients, healthcare...
